We\u2019ll also give you tips for mentioning a referral in your cover letter.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\">What Does Getting Referred Mean?<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Getting referred by an employee means a current employee recommends you for a job opening at their company. Instead of applying on your own, someone who works at the company puts your application forward because they believe you&#8217;re a good fit for the role.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Employee referrals make up just 6% of job applications but account for <a href=\"https:\/\/boterview.com\/a\/employee-referral-statistics\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\">37% of all hires<\/a>. This is why many companies encourage employee referral programs.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\">Benefits of Getting Referred by an Employee<\/h2>\n\n\n<div class=\"wp-block-image\">\n<figure class=\"aligncenter size-large\"><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" width=\"1024\" height=\"512\" src=\"https:\/\/www.jumpresumebuilder.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/08\/The-Benefits-of-Being-Referred-1024x512.jpg\" alt=\"Benefits of Getting Referred by an Employee\" class=\"wp-image-4400\" srcset=\"https:\/\/www.jumpresumebuilder.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/08\/The-Benefits-of-Being-Referred-1024x512.jpg 1024w, https:\/\/www.jumpresumebuilder.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/08\/The-Benefits-of-Being-Referred-300x150.jpg 300w, https:\/\/www.jumpresumebuilder.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/08\/The-Benefits-of-Being-Referred-768x384.jpg 768w, https:\/\/www.jumpresumebuilder.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/08\/The-Benefits-of-Being-Referred-1536x768.jpg 1536w, https:\/\/www.jumpresumebuilder.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/08\/The-Benefits-of-Being-Referred-2048x1024.jpg 2048w\" sizes=\"auto, (max-width: 1024px) 100vw, 1024px\" \/><\/figure>\n<\/div>\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">An employee referral does more than connect you with a recruiter. It may open the door, but you still need to earn the job.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\">Does Getting Referred by an Employee Guarantee an Interview?<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">A referral doesn&#8217;t guarantee an interview or a job. Hiring managers still evaluate your resume, skills, and experience before making a decision. However, referrals can give your application more visibility.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\">How Does the Employee Referral Process Work?<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Every company has its own hiring process, but employee referrals usually follow a similar path. Most employees are happy to recommend someone they believe will represent them well. The key is to make it easy for them to say yes. Here\u2019s how to get a job referral:<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\">Connect with People Who Know Your Work<\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">The best referrals come from people who can genuinely speak about your skills. This could be a former coworker, manager, classmate, mentor, or someone you&#8217;ve worked with on a project.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">If you&#8217;ve only exchanged a few LinkedIn messages, don&#8217;t expect an immediate referral. Build the relationship first.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\">Explain Why You&#8217;re Interested in the Role<\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Don&#8217;t just ask, &#8220;Can you refer me?&#8221;<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Tell them why you&#8217;re applying, what excites you about the role, and why you think you&#8217;re a good fit. This gives them something meaningful to share if a recruiter asks why they recommended you.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\">Share an Updated Resume<\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Make the process simple for the person referring you. Send your latest resume along with the job title or link to the posting. A clear, tailored resume also helps the employee feel more confident about recommending you.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\">Respect Their Decision<\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Not everyone can make a referral. Some companies have strict policies, while others expect employees to refer only people they know well.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">If someone says no, thank them anyway. They <em>did<\/em> take some time to review your request. A respectful response leaves the door open for future opportunities.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\">How to Mention a Referral in Your Cover Letter?<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">If an employee has agreed to refer you, mention it in the opening paragraph of your cover letter. This gives the hiring manager context right away. Keep it brief, and focus on your qualifications rather than the referral itself.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Here\u2019s an example of mentioning a referral in a cover letter:<\/p>\n\n\n\n<figure class=\"wp-block-table\"><table class=\"has-fixed-layout\"><tbody><tr><td>Dear Hiring Manager,<br>I am excited to apply for the Marketing Coordinator position at ABC Company. My former colleague, Sarah Johnson, encouraged me to apply for this role. Sarah and I worked together for two years, and she believed my experience in digital marketing and content strategy would make me a strong fit for your team.<\/td><\/tr><\/tbody><\/table><\/figure>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">After the opening, continue your cover letter as you normally would.
